The Schaumburg Township Council of PTAs will host a candidates' forum at 7 p.m. Wednesday, Oct. 10, at Addams Junior High School, 700 S. Springinsguth Road in Schaumburg. Invited are Democrat Fred Crespo and Republican Ramiro Juarez from the 44th District House race, Democrat Michelle Mussman and Republican John Lawson in the 56th District House race, Democrat Michael Noland and Republican Cary Collins in the 22nd District Senate race, and Democrat Dan Kotowski and Republican Jim O'Donnell in the 28th District Senate race. The candidates will answer questions directly affecting children, education and the future of Illinois. Written questions from the audience will be screened and moderated by the STC.
